NRA National Firearms Museum

Nestled in the heart of Fairfax, Virginia, the NRA National Firearms Museum stands as a testament to the rich and varied history of firearms in the United States. As one of the premier firearms museums in the world, it offers visitors an unparalleled opportunity to explore the evolution of firearms technology and its profound impact on American culture and society.


Founded by the National Rifle Association (NRA) in 1935, the museum boasts a vast collection of over 15,000 firearms spanning more than seven centuries. From antique muskets and flintlock pistols to modern rifles and handguns, the museum's exhibits showcase the diversity and ingenuity of firearms craftsmanship throughout history.


One of the museum's most remarkable features is its meticulously curated galleries, which are arranged thematically to highlight different periods and aspects of firearms history. Visitors can embark on a chronological journey through time, starting with the early days of colonial America and progressing through the Revolutionary War, the Civil War, and beyond.


In addition to its historical exhibits, the NRA National Firearms Museum also houses a stunning array of firearms from Hollywood movies, television shows, and iconic moments in American history. Visitors can marvel at guns wielded by legendary figures such as Annie Oakley and Theodore Roosevelt, as well as those used in famous films like "Dirty Harry" and "Saving Private Ryan."
